| /* SPDX-License-Identifier: LGPL-2.1-or-later */ |
| |
| #include <errno.h> |
| #include <fcntl.h> |
| #include <unistd.h> |
| |
| #include "alloc-util.h" |
| #include "errno-util.h" |
| #include "fd-util.h" |
| #include "fileio.h" |
| #include "generator.h" |
| #include "log.h" |
| #include "mkdir-label.h" |
| #include "parse-util.h" |
| #include "path-util.h" |
| #include "process-util.h" |
| #include "proc-cmdline.h" |
| #include "strv.h" |
| #include "terminal-util.h" |
| #include "unit-name.h" |
| #include "virt.h" |
| |
| static const char *arg_dest = NULL; |
| static bool arg_enabled = true; |
| |
| static int add_symlink(const char *fservice, const char *tservice) { |
| char *from, *to; |
| int r; |
| |
| assert(fservice); |
| assert(tservice); |
| |
| from = strjoina(SYSTEM_DATA_UNIT_DIR "/", fservice); |
| to = strjoina(arg_dest, "/getty.target.wants/", tservice); |
| |
| (void) mkdir_parents_label(to, 0755); |
| |
| r = symlink(from, to); |
| if (r < 0) { |
| /* In case console=hvc0 is passed this will very likely result in EEXIST */ |
| if (errno == EEXIST) |
| return 0; |
| |
| return log_error_errno(errno, "Failed to create symlink %s: %m", to); |
| } |
| |
| return 0; |
| } |
| |
| static int add_serial_getty(const char *tty)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*n = NULL; |
| int r; |
| |
| assert(tty); |
| |
| log_debug("Automatically adding serial getty for /dev/%s.", tty); |
| |
| r = unit_name_from_path_instance("serial-getty", tty, ".service", &n);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return log_error_errno(r, "Failed to generate service name: %m"); |
| |
| return add_symlink("serial-getty@.service", n); |
| } |
| |
| static int add_container_getty(const char *tty)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*n = NULL; |
| int r; |
| |
| assert(tty); |
| |
| log_debug("Automatically adding container getty for /dev/pts/%s.", tty); |
| |
| r = unit_name_from_path_instance("container-getty", tty, ".service", &n);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return log_error_errno(r, "Failed to generate service name: %m"); |
| |
| return add_symlink("container-getty@.service", n); |
| } |
| |
| static int verify_tty(const char *name) { |
| _cleanup_close_ int fd = -EBADF; |
| const char *p; |
| |
| /* Some TTYs are weird and have been enumerated but don't work |
| * when you try to use them, such as classic ttyS0 and |
| * friends. Let's check that and open the device and run |
| * isatty() on it. */ |
| |
| p = strjoina("/dev/", name); |
| |
| /* O_NONBLOCK is essential here, to make sure we don't wait |
| * for DCD */ |
| fd = open(p, O_RDWR|O_NONBLOCK|O_NOCTTY|O_CLOEXEC|O_NOFOLLOW); |
| if (fd < 0) |
| return -errno; |
| |
| errno = 0; |
| if (isatty(fd) <= 0) |
| return errno_or_else(EIO); |
| |
| return 0; |
| } |
| |
| static int run_container(void)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*container_ttys = NULL; |
| int r; |
| |
| log_debug("Automatically adding console shell."); |
| |
| r = add_symlink("console-getty.service", "console-getty.service");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return r; |
| |
| /* When $container_ttys is set for PID 1, spawn gettys on all ptys named therein. |
| * Note that despite the variable name we only support ptys here. */ |
| |
| (void) getenv_for_pid(1, "container_ttys", &container_ttys); |
| |
| for (const char *p = container_ttys;;)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*word = NULL; |
| |
| r = extract_first_word(&p, &word, NULL, 0);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return log_error_errno(r, "Failed to parse $container_ttys: %m"); |
| if (r == 0) |
| return 0; |
| |
| const char *tty = word; |
| |
| /* First strip off /dev/ if it is specified */ |
| tty = path_startswith(tty, "/dev/") ?: tty; |
| |
| /* Then, make sure it's actually a pty */ |
| tty = path_startswith(tty, "pts/"); |
| if (!tty) |
| continue; |
| |
| r = add_container_getty(tty);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return r; |
| } |
| } |
| |
| static int parse_proc_cmdline_item(const char *key, const char *value, void *data) { |
| int r; |
| |
| assert(key); |
| |
| if (proc_cmdline_key_streq(key, "systemd.getty_auto")) { |
| r = value ? parse_boolean(value) : 1; |
| if (r < 0) |
| log_warning_errno(r, "Failed to parse getty_auto switch \"%s\", ignoring: %m", value); |
| else |
| arg_enabled = r; |
| } |
| |
| return 0; |
| } |
| |
| static int run(const char *dest, const char *dest_early, const char *dest_late)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*getty_auto = NULL; |
| int r; |
| |
| assert_se(arg_dest = dest); |
| |
| r = proc_cmdline_parse(parse_proc_cmdline_item, NULL, 0); |
| if (r < 0) |
| log_warning_errno(r, "Failed to parse kernel command line, ignoring: %m"); |
| |
| r = getenv_for_pid(1, "SYSTEMD_GETTY_AUTO", &getty_auto); |
| if (r < 0) |
| log_warning_errno(r, "Failed to parse $SYSTEMD_GETTY_AUTO environment variable, ignoring: %m"); |
| else if (r > 0) { |
| r = parse_boolean(getty_auto); |
| if (r < 0) |
| log_warning_errno(r, "Failed to parse $SYSTEMD_GETTY_AUTO value \"%s\", ignoring: %m", getty_auto); |
| else |
| arg_enabled = r; |
| } |
| |
| if (!arg_enabled) { |
| log_debug("Disabled, exiting."); |
| return 0; |
| } |
| |
| if (detect_container() > 0) |
| /* Add console shell and look at $container_ttys, but don't do add any |
| * further magic if we are in a container. */ |
| return run_container(); |
| |
| /* Automatically add in a serial getty on all active kernel consoles */ |
| _cleanup_free_ char *active = NULL; |
| (void) read_one_line_file("/sys/class/tty/console/active", &active); |
| for (const char *p = active;;) {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*tty = NULL; |
| |
| r = extract_first_word(&p, &tty, NULL, 0);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return log_error_errno(r, "Failed to parse /sys/class/tty/console/active: %m"); |
| if (r == 0) |
| break; |
| |
| /* We assume that gettys on virtual terminals are started via manual configuration and do |
| * this magic only for non-VC terminals. */ |
| |
| if (isempty(tty) || tty_is_vc(tty)) |
| continue; |
| |
| if (verify_tty(tty) < 0) |
| continue; |
| |
| r = add_serial_getty(tty);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return r; |
| } |
| |
| /* Automatically add in a serial getty on the first virtualizer console */ |
| FOREACH_STRING(j, |
| "hvc0", |
| "xvc0", |
| "hvsi0", |
| "sclp_line0", |
| "ttysclp0", |
| "3270!tty1") { |
| _cleanup_free_ char *p = NULL; |
| |
| p = path_join("/sys/class/tty", j); |
| if (!p) |
| return -ENOMEM; |
| if (access(p, F_OK) < 0) |
| continue; |
| |
| r = add_serial_getty(j); |
| if (r < 0) |
| return r; |
| } |
| |
| return 0; |
| } |
| |
| DEFINE_MAIN_GENERATOR_FUNCTION(run); |
